Directed by Ram Gopal Varma, The Attacks of 26/11 is a 2013 Indian Hindi-language action thriller film. The narrative provides a cinematic reconstruction of the tragic 2008 Mumbai attacks.

The movie features a powerful cast, including veteran actor Nana Patekar as then-Joint Commissioner of Police Rakesh Maria. Notably, it marked the film debut of Sanjeev Jaiswal, who portrays the captured terrorist Ajmal Kasab. The film is known for its raw, unflinching depiction of the attacks, sticking closely to the authentic sequence of events and serving as a tribute to the victims. It has a runtime of 116 minutes and was produced on a budget of approximately ₹22 crore.

The Attacks of 26/11 is a 2013 Indian Hindi‑language action thriller film directed by Ram Gopal Varma. The film is based on the book Kasab: The Face of 26/11 by Rommel Rodrigues, which focuses on Ajmal Kasab, the sole surviving perpetrator of the horrific 2008 Mumbai terror attacks. The attacks, which lasted nearly 60 hours, saw ten heavily armed terrorists from a Pakistan‑based militant group launch coordinated assaults on multiple iconic locations across Mumbai, including the Taj Mahal Palace Hotel, Oberoi Trident, Chhatrapati Shivaji Terminus, Leopold Cafe, and Nariman House. The death toll stood at 166, with over 300 injured.
